Originally Posted by Mad Matt
No way RS500 BTCC cars used 4.44 mate. Group A rally cars yes, and as you said it gives really a big push on twisty roads !
Wrong , what you dont understand is correct gearing in the gearbox , the touring cars had direct top gearboxes , 1:1 5th .
4.44 is still the most popular available ratio , you just need to sort the ratios in the box and wheel sizes to suit this .
